Output 4fcc75c071d72b3fcda25c0a4362cbb44b5f3a9aea27f466f26f6d0d26a0f29e:0

value
11308320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ec81144866f60bde1712551d3a6ca7f57a1381a0 OP_EQUAL
address
3PFY2Q2cPga7gkKmCuCmH2hk6SLjXHiL2U
transaction
4fcc75c071d72b3fcda25c0a4362cbb44b5f3a9aea27f466f26f6d0d26a0f29e
spent
true